@sentry/junior-notion
@sentry/junior-notion adds read-only Notion search workflows for pages and data sources to Junior through Notion's hosted MCP server.
Install it alongside @sentry/junior:
pnpm add @sentry/junior @sentry/junior-notionThen register the plugin package in withJunior(...):
import { withJunior } from "@sentry/junior/config";
export default withJunior({
pluginPackages: ["@sentry/junior-notion"],
});This package does not use NOTION_TOKEN or a shared workspace integration. Each user connects their own Notion account the first time Junior calls a Notion MCP tool. Junior sends the OAuth link privately and resumes the thread automatically after the user authorizes.
Junior intentionally keeps this package read-only by exposing only Notion's notion-search and notion-fetch MCP tools. The plugin does not expose create, update, move, or other write-capable Notion tools.
Search limitations
This package uses Notion MCP search and fetch rather than the older REST helper flow.
- Search is still title-biased, so prompts work best when users search for the actual page or data source title.
- Results can differ from the Notion UI even when the user can see a page in the app.
- Search across connected sources like Slack, Google Drive, and Jira requires a Notion AI plan. Without Notion AI, search is limited to the user's Notion workspace.
- Missing results are usually a permissions problem on the user's Notion account or a weak query phrase.
Auth model
- Notion MCP requires user-based OAuth and does not support bearer token authentication.
- This package is not suitable for fully headless or unattended automation.
- Users can disconnect from Junior App Home with
Unlink, or by asking Junior to disconnect Notion.
